Mary Jo Hack-Save (McCormick) passed away on May 14, 2020 and according to her; no one needs to know her age. She was a spirited lass with a sharp wit and even sharper tongue. Her love of adventure took her many places; whiskey-drinking in the mountains of Gatlinburg, St. Patrick’s Day kilt inspector in New York and hanging upside down kissing the Blarney Stone of Ireland. If you were lucky enough to be on an adventure with her you were guaranteed a memorable experience. Her love of music was only eclipsed by her talent for playing the spoons or lively squeezebox tunes. She was known to kick up her heels to any hearty Irish jig, two-step strut to Rod Stewarts “Hot Legs” or lately her workout that included “Candy Shop” by 50 Cent.

Of all of the places on earth, her favorite place to be was on the boat beside Papa Max who proceeded her in death. They are now forever cruising together on their boat “My Darling” with the blender going strong full of ice cream drinks and music filling the air.

For us she was the magnificent matriarch of the family clan, children George Hack (Kathleen), Lauren Wuellner (Derek Mohring), Anne Owens (Marcus) and step-children, grandchildren, great grandchildren, cousins, nieces, nephews and all of the McCormick Family. She was blessed to have many great friends that spanned her incredible life. Any gatherings put her at the center of attention where her life of the party attitude and total embracement of a good time spilled out. We all hope to carry on the fine traditions she has instilled in us by raising glass in her name for a fine proper Irish toast!

“May your glass be ever full.
May the roof over your head be always strong.
And may you be in heaven
half an hour before the devil knows you're dead”
Sláinte

A celebration of life honoring Mary Jo will be held at a later date.

The family requests in lieu of flowers a memorial donation in Mary Jo's memory can be made to either St. Francis De Sales of Toledo. . or St Ursula Academy.

Mary Jo's family would like to extend their gratitude to all of the staff at ProMedica Hospice for their loving care of their dear mom during this last chapter of her precious life.
